Accuracy And Limitations Of Localized Green’S Function Methods For Materials Science Applications, Duane D. Johnson, Andrei V. Smirnov Dec 2001

Accuracy And Limitations Of Localized Green’S Function Methods For Materials Science Applications, Duane D. Johnson, Andrei V. Smirnov

Duane D. Johnson

We compare screened real-space and reciprocal-space implementations of Korringa-Kohn-Rostoker electronic-structure method for their applicability to largescale problems requiring various levels of accuracy. We show that real-space calculations in metals can become impractical to describe energies. We suggest a combined r- and k-space scheme as the most efficient and flexible strategy for accurate energy calculations. Our hybrid code is suitable for (parallel) large-scale calculations involving complex, multicomponent systems. We also discuss how details of numerical procedures can affect accuracy of such calculations.

We present the first precision measurement of the spin-dependent asymmetry in the threshold region of 3He (e,e') at Q2 values of 0.1 and 0.2(GeV/c)2. The agreement between the data and nonrelativistic Faddeev calculations which include both final-state interactions and meson-exchange current effects is very good at Q2=0.1(GeV/c)2, while a small discrepancy at Q2=0.2(GeV/c)2 is observed.


Finiteness Notions In Fuzzy Sets, Lawrence Stout Nov 2001

Finiteness Notions In Fuzzy Sets, Lawrence Stout

Lawrence N. Stout

Finite sets are one of the most fundamental mathematical structures. In the absence of the axiom of choice there are many different inequivalent definitions of finite even in classical logic. When we allow incomplete existence as in fuzzy sets the situation gets even more complicated. This paper gives nine distinct definitions of finite in a fuzzy context together with examples showing how the properties of the underlying lattice of truth values impact the meanings of finite.


Oral History Interview With William Mcgee, Philip L. Frana Nov 2001

Oral History Interview With William Mcgee, Philip L. Frana

Philip L Frana

William McGee is a retired senior programmer at the IBM Santa Teresa Laboratory. McGee received the AB degree in physics from the University of California at Berkeley in 1949, and the MA degree in physics from Columbia University in 1951. From 1951 to 1959, McGee managed the numerical analysis unit at the General Electric Hanford Atomic Products Operation in Richland, Washington. Between 1959 and 1964 he led systems programming and research at Ramo Wooldridge Corporation in Canoga Park, California. McGee joined ...

Oral History Interview With Donald D. Chamberlin, Philip L. Frana Oct 2001

Oral History Interview With Donald D. Chamberlin, Philip L. Frana

Philip L Frana

Don Chamberlin is a research staff member at IBM Almaden Research Center in San Jose, California. In this oral history Chamberlin recounts his early life, his education at Harvey Mudd College and Stanford University, and his work on relational database technology. Chamberlin was a member of the System R research team and, with Ray Boyce, developed the SQL database language. Chamberlin also briefly discusses his more recent research on XML query languages.


Relativistic Effects And Two-Body Currents In 2h(E⃗,E′P)N Using Out-Of-Plane Detection, Z L. Zhou, X Jiang, R Hicks, A Hotta, R Miskimen, Gerald Alvin Peterson, J Shaw Oct 2001

Relativistic Effects And Two-Body Currents In 2h(E⃗,E′P)N Using Out-Of-Plane Detection, Z L. Zhou, X Jiang, R Hicks, A Hotta, R Miskimen, Gerald Alvin Peterson, J Shaw

Gerald Alvin Peterson

Measurements of the 2H(e⃗,e′p)n reaction were performed with the out-of-plane magnetic spectrometers (OOPS) at the MIT-Bates Linear Accelerator. The longitudinal-transverse, fLT and fLT′, and the transverse-transverse, fTT, interference responses at a missing momentum of 210MeV/c were simultaneously extracted in the dip region at Q2 = 0.15 (GeV/c)2. In comparison to models of deuteron electrodisintegration, the data clearly reveal strong effects of relativity and final-state interactions and the importance of two-body meson-exchange currents and isobar configurations. We demonstrate that such effects can be disentangled by extracting these responses using the novel out-of-plane technique.

Odpady Pestycydowe Jako Paliwo Zastępcze W Piecach Obrotowych Do Wypalania Klinkieru Cementowego, Marian Mazur, Robert Oleniacz, Marek Bogacki, Stanisław Słupek Oct 2001

Odpady Pestycydowe Jako Paliwo Zastępcze W Piecach Obrotowych Do Wypalania Klinkieru Cementowego, Marian Mazur, Robert Oleniacz, Marek Bogacki, Stanisław Słupek

Robert Oleniacz

The clinker burning plant is ideally suited for processing a wide variety of hazardous waste materials. High temperatures existing in cement kilns (ca. 1350-1450 Centigrades in the burning zone) as well as long gas-residence time (ca. 6-10 s) provide potentially excellent conditions for destruction of toxic organic compounds. Non-volatile compounds are retained in the solid phase and built into the clinker. A lot of other (for example acid gases) can also be absorbed by alkaline solid phase. Oral History Interview With Mark P. Mccahill, Philip L. Frana Sep 2001

Oral History Interview With Mark P. Mccahill, Philip L. Frana

Philip L Frana

In this oral history Mark P. McCahill, Assistant Director of Academic and Distributed Computing Services at the University of Minnesota, recounts his role as leader of the team that created the popular client/server software for organizing and sharing information on the Internet. McCahill also describes his work in the development of Pop Mail, Gopher VR, Forms Nirvana, the Electronic Grants Management System, and the University of Minnesota Portal.


Line Forces In Keplerian Circumstellar Disks And Precession Of Nearly Circular Orbits., K. G. Gayley, R. Ignace, S. P. Owocki Sep 2001

Line Forces In Keplerian Circumstellar Disks And Precession Of Nearly Circular Orbits., K. G. Gayley, R. Ignace, S. P. Owocki

Richard Ignace

We examine the effects of optically thick line forces on orbiting circumstellar disks, such as occur around Be stars. For radially streaming radiation, line forces are only effective if there is a strong radial velocity gradient, as occurs, for example, in a line-driven stellar wind. However, within an orbiting disk, the radial shear of the azimuthal velocity leads to strong line-of-sight velocity velocity gradients along nonradial directions.
